I'm no expert, but I vaguely remember some other member tried a similar setup with F350 coils and they didn't work, no matter how hard he tried. I think he tried F250 coils and they wouldn't slip into the disc to tighten down without hitting the steering knuckle.
I think this may apply, I'm unsure. Maybe another member can fill in the blanks for me.
I recently,(last year) swapped my OE springs with a set of MOOG HD springs. Brought the front end up and took the sagginess out. Remember that if you swap coils with something other, or maybe new OE coild, you shoul dhave it aligned again to correct any distortion in the Camber and Caster.
I didn't, and it wore my Pass. side tire down a wee bit more and started pulling terrible as the months went on. about 800 miles was all it took. It didn't or I do not recall it doing it after I replaced them, as I'm a poor man and I like to enjoy the money I spend on my truck, not tearing things up.
I also got the Skyjacker dual shock option for my '92 and added 4 bilsteins to the front. Took that back jarring pain out. Lot smoother ride.
